DESCRIPTION
The Si9988 is an integrated, buffered H-bridge with TTL compatible inputs and the capability of delivering a continuous 0.65 A @ VDD = 5 V (room temperature) at switching rates up to 200 kHz. Internal logic prevents the upper and lower outputs of either half-bridge from being turned on simultaneously. Both outputs may be forced low (for motor braking) by pulling EN to logic high. The Si9988 is available in both standard and lead (Pb)-free, 8-pin TSSOP packages, specified to operate over a voltage range of 3.8 V to 13.2 V, and the industrial temperature range of −40 to 85_C (D suffix).

ABSOLUTE MAXIMUM RATINGSa
VDD .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 15 V Voltage on any pin with respect to ground . . . . . . . . . . . −0.3 V to VDD +0.3 V Voltage on pins 5, 8 with respect to GND . . . . . . . . . . . . . . −1 V to VDD +1 V Voltage on pins 6, 7 .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. −0.3 V to GND +1 V Peak Output Current .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 1 A Storage Temperature .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. −65 to 150_C Junction Temperature (TJ) .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 150_C Continous Iout current (TJ = 135_C, YDD = 5V) TA = 25_C .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 0.67A TA = 85_C .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 0.47A Power Dissipationb .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 0.83 W qJA .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 120_C/W Operating Temperature Range .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. −40 to 85_C Notes a. Device mounted with all leads soldered or welded to PC board. b. Derate 8.3 mW/_C above 25_C. c. TJ = TA + (PD)(qJA), PD = Power Dissipation.
Stresses beyond those listed under “Absolute Maximum Ratings” may cause permanent damage to the device. These are stress ratings only, and functional operation of the device at these or any other conditions beyond those indicated in the operational sections of the specifications is not implied. Exposure to absolute maximum rating conditions for extended periods may affect device reliability.
RECOMMENDED OPERATING RANGE
VDD .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 3.8 V to 13.2 V Maximum Junction Temperature (TJ) .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 135_C
